I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VBScript Discussion :

Ouverture de 4 sites internet dans 4 fenêtres séparées


Sujet :

VBScript

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2010
    Messages
    29
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Janvier 2010
    Messages : 29
    Points : 22
    Points
    22
    Par défaut Ouverture de 4 sites internet dans 4 fenêtres séparées
    Bonjour le forum,

    Actuellement, j'utilise le script suivant pour ouvrir 4 sites internet.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    set WshShell = CreateObject("WScript.Shell")
    Set objExplorer = CreateObject("InternetExplorer.Application")
    objExplorer.navigate "http://www.ing.be"
    objExplorer.navigate "http://www.gamerz.be"
    objExplorer.navigate "http://www.google.be"
    objExplorer.navigate "http://www.lesoir.be"
    wscript.sleep 100
    objExplorer.Visible=True
    Mais ... ce script ouvre les sites dans 4 onglets d'une même session internet explorer.

    Je souhaiterais que pour chaque site, une fenêtre internet soit ouverte.

    Any idea to help me ?

    Merci d'avance

  2. #2
    Membre éprouvé
    Profil pro
    Inscrit en
    Janvier 2007
    Messages
    948
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2007
    Messages : 948
    Points : 1 111
    Points
    1 111
    Par défaut
    Et si tu crées 4 objExplorer distincts, ca marche pas?

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Janvier 2010
    Messages
    29
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Janvier 2010
    Messages : 29
    Points : 22
    Points
    22
    Par défaut
    Comme ça ?

    Ca change rien :/
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    set WshShell = CreateObject("WScript.Shell")
    Set objExplorer1 = CreateObject("InternetExplorer.Application")
    Set objExplorer2 = CreateObject("InternetExplorer.Application")
    Set objExplorer3 = CreateObject("InternetExplorer.Application")
    Set objExplorer4 = CreateObject("InternetExplorer.Application")
    objExplorer1.navigate "http://www.ing.be"
    objExplorer2.navigate "http://www.gamerz.be"
    objExplorer3.navigate "http://www.google.be"
    objExplorer4.navigate "http://www.lesoir.be"
    wscript.sleep 100
    objExplorer1.Visible=True
    objExplorer2.Visible=True
    objExplorer3.Visible=True
    objExplorer4.Visible=True

  4. #4
    Modérateur
    Avatar de ProgElecT
    Homme Profil pro
    Retraité
    Inscrit en
    Décembre 2004
    Messages
    6 077
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 68
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Retraité
    Secteur : Communication - Médias

    Informations forums :
    Inscription : Décembre 2004
    Messages : 6 077
    Points : 17 175
    Points
    17 175
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    Dim Sortie
    Dim objExplorer
    Dim READYSTATE_COMPLETE
    READYSTATE_COMPLETE = 4
     
    Sub Ouvrire(Url)
    Sortie = DateAdd("S", 10, Now) 'ajoute de 10 Sc par apport à l'heure systeme
    objExplorer.navigate Url, 1 ' ajout du parametre 1 pour les sites suivants
    Do
     If Now >= Sortie Then Exit Do
    Loop Until objExplorer.readyState = READYSTATE_COMPLETE
    objExplorer.Visible=True
    End sub
     
    Set objExplorer = CreateObject("InternetExplorer.Application")
     
    Sortie = DateAdd("S", 10, Now) 'ajoute de 10 Sc par apport à l'heure systeme
    objExplorer.navigate "http://www.ing.be" 'pas de parametre supplementaire pour le 1° site
    Do
     If Now >= Sortie Then Exit Do
    Loop Until objExplorer.readyState = READYSTATE_COMPLETE
    objExplorer.Visible=True
     
    Ouvrire "http://www.gamerz.be"
    Ouvrire "http://www.google.be"
    Ouvrire "http://www.developpez.net/forums/d898790/autres-langages/general-visual-basic-6-vbscript/vbscript/ouverture-4-sites-internet-4-fenetres-separees/#post5095857"
    Reste a gérer un site non disponible
    Soyez sympa, pensez -y
    Balises[CODE]...[/CODE]
    Balises[CODE=NomDuLangage]...[/CODE] quand vous mettez du code d'un autre langage que celui du forum ou vous postez.
    Balises[C]...[/C] code intégré dans une phrase.
    Balises[C=NomDuLangage]...[/C] code intégré dans une phrase quand vous mettez du code d'un autre langage que celui du forum ou vous postez.
    Le bouton en fin de discussion, quand vous avez obtenu l'aide attendue.
    ......... et pourquoi pas, pour remercier, un pour celui/ceux qui vous ont dépannés.
    👉 → → Ma page perso sur DVP ← ← 👈

Discussions similaires

  1. [XL-2010] ouvrir excel dans deux fenêtres séparées
    Par UDSP50 dans le forum Excel
    Réponses: 5
    Dernier message: 15/05/2015, 12h57
  2. Réponses: 3
    Dernier message: 26/04/2010, 23h36
  3. Réponses: 0
    Dernier message: 30/06/2009, 09h47
  4. Réponses: 3
    Dernier message: 20/07/2006, 15h41

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o